Accurate Leak Detection
Modern industrial processes demand unprecedented reliability, and even minor breaches can result in significant financial losses and environmental damage. Detailed leak identification is rapidly evolving beyond traditional methods, now incorporating techniques like ultrasonic scanning, helium mass spectrometry, and infrared thermography. These advanced techniques allow for the pinpointing of even microscopic defects in pressurized systems – from pipelines and vessels to complex machinery. The ability to quickly identify these leaks minimizes downtime, reduces wasted resources, and ensures compliance to increasingly stringent safety standards. Furthermore, proactive leak plans based on precise data empower maintenance teams to address issues before they escalate, contributing to a more sustainable and efficient operation.

Component Leak Testing
A critical stage in production processes, pressure leak testing confirms the soundness of sealed assemblies. This testing method typically involves supplying a diagnostic pressure to the assembly and then monitoring for any loss in that pressure over a specified period. Numerous techniques exist, including bubble testing, helium leak detection, and tracer gas methods, each selected based on the specific requirements of the usage and the dimension of the escape being sought. Successful pressure leak testing demonstrates the absence of unwanted escapes, leading to a more trustworthy and operative product.

Undamaging Leak Locating
Employing damage-free techniques, leak detection has progressed significantly, minimizing the need for intrusive correction procedures. These advanced systems often utilize acoustic imaging, helium leak testing, and fluid decay analysis to pinpoint precisely the location of leaks within intricate systems – all without the need for major disassembly or invasive physical inspection. This technique is particularly beneficial for maintaining the performance of sensitive equipment and lessening costly downtime.
